    in Chinese and Western, and achieves thorough understandings of traditional and modem philosophies.
    He has not only made outstanding contributions to a systematic study on the history of Chinese philosophy,
    but also made his theoretical creation characterized is own distinct personality and the time.
    He treats a theoretical system of wisdom, which has been promoting the development of China’s philosophy
    and offers it a new appearance to converge into the world philosophy. He leaves us a very precious
    spiritual heritage.
